Posts

Showing posts from May 25, 2020

Vim Killer

Comments from Hacker News https://ift.tt/30l28an via

Vim Killer

Article URL: https://github.com/caseykneale/VIMKiller Comments URL: https://news.ycombinator.com/item?id=23306514 Points: 19 # Comments: 6 from Hacker News: Front Page https://ift.tt/30l28an via

The Future of College Is Online, and It’s Cheaper

Comments from Hacker News https://ift.tt/2TE07DZ via

Counterfactual Regret Minimization with Kuhn Poker

Comments from Hacker News https://ift.tt/36iiwLP via

The Future of College Is Online, and It’s Cheaper

Article URL: https://www.nytimes.com/2020/05/25/opinion/online-college-coronavirus.html Comments URL: https://news.ycombinator.com/item?id=23307202 Points: 14 # Comments: 7 from Hacker News: Front Page https://ift.tt/2TE07DZ via

Mastodon: Add end-to-end encryption API

Article URL: https://github.com/tootsuite/mastodon/pull/13820 Comments URL: https://news.ycombinator.com/item?id=23307053 Points: 23 # Comments: 2 from Hacker News: Front Page https://ift.tt/2TA4yje via

Mastodon: Add end-to-end encryption API

Comments from Hacker News https://ift.tt/2TA4yje via

Show HN: Dsnet, a simple command to manage a centralised WireGuard VPN

Comments from Hacker News https://ift.tt/3gjGFGi via

A Better Joel Test: The Developer Culture Test

Article URL: https://blog.pragmaticengineer.com/the-developer-culture-test/ Comments URL: https://news.ycombinator.com/item?id=23305460 Points: 37 # Comments: 12 from Hacker News: Front Page https://ift.tt/3eePZdE via

Why every tech downturn has a silver lining

Comments from Hacker News https://ift.tt/2APGwKu via

Sod – An Embedded Computer Vision and Machine Learning Tiny C Library

Article URL: https://sod.pixlab.io/ Comments URL: https://news.ycombinator.com/item?id=23306480 Points: 14 # Comments: 2 from Hacker News: Front Page https://sod.pixlab.io/ via

Today’s JavaScript, from an Outsider’s Perspective

Comments from Hacker News https://ift.tt/2B1zCCa via

Sod – An Embedded Computer Vision and Machine Learning Tiny C Library

Comments from Hacker News https://sod.pixlab.io/ via

Quines (self-replicating programs)

Comments from Hacker News https://ift.tt/RPC5O1 via

A Better Joel Test: The Developer Culture Test

Comments from Hacker News https://ift.tt/3eePZdE via

Today’s JavaScript, from an Outsider’s Perspective

Article URL: http://lea.verou.me/2020/05/todays-javascript-from-an-outsiders-perspective/ Comments URL: https://news.ycombinator.com/item?id=23306382 Points: 8 # Comments: 1 from Hacker News: Front Page https://ift.tt/2B1zCCa via

Lies, Damned Lies, and Stock-Based Compensation

Article URL: https://tanay.substack.com/p/lies-damned-lies-and-stock-based Comments URL: https://news.ycombinator.com/item?id=23306104 Points: 41 # Comments: 2 from Hacker News: Front Page https://ift.tt/2TDTSQA via

Lies, Damned Lies, and Stock-Based Compensation

Comments from Hacker News https://ift.tt/2TDTSQA via

SCI Runs OpenVMS on x86-64

Comments from Hacker News https://ift.tt/3gniUNK via

Members – For Managing Associations and Clubs

Comments from Hacker News https://ift.tt/2X1S324 via

Show HN: A Simple COBOL Game, TicTacTOBOL

Comments from Hacker News https://ift.tt/2yvkj3D via

SCI Runs OpenVMS on x86-64

Article URL: https://www.sciinc.com/remotevms/vms_techinfo/vms_news/OpenVMSOnX86-64.asp Comments URL: https://news.ycombinator.com/item?id=23305598 Points: 4 # Comments: 2 from Hacker News: Front Page https://ift.tt/3gniUNK via

Ask HN: Has anybody shipped a web app at scale with 1 DB per account?

A common way of deploying a web application database at scale is to setup a MySQL or Postgres server, create one table for all customers, and have an account_id or owner_if field and let the application code handle security. This makes it easier to run database migrations and upgrade code per customer all at once. I’m curious if anybody has taken the approach of provisioning one database per account? This means you’d have to run migrations per account and keep track of all the migration versions and statuses somewhere. Additionally, if an application has custom fields or columns, the differences would have to be tracked somehow and name space collisions managed. Has anybody done this? Particularly with Rails? What kinda of tools or processes did you learn when you did it? Would you do it again? What are some interesting trade offs between the two approaches? Comments URL: https://news.ycombinator.com/item?id=23305111 Points: 26 # Comments: 31 from Hacker News: Front Page https...